While I was staring unblinkingly at the Smash Bros Dojo site (which still hasn’t changed) and watching the last two episodes of Heroes for the season (what a lousy ending, am I right?) I missed the fact that Nintendo dumped out a pile of release dates, including my most anticipated Wii title, Metroid Prime 3! August 20th! Of this year!! Must… purchase!

So much for my prediction that it would slide to 2008. Didn’t do that. I wasn’t complaining either, because hey, if it never arrives, it will keep getting better and better until it will be too good to play. It will be like the gaming equivalent of those cakes from Food Network Challenge that are like, six feet tall and made of huge razor-edged shards of sugar glass. You can’t eat those, you’ll die.

Also in August comes Heroes of Mana, the really cool looking strategy game from Square-Enix. That’s on the 14th. Nothing else on the list I really care for, actually.
